Can you fetch messages manually?
Please Login to Remove!
I have one of my email accounts setup through BIS through my OWA account at work. I understand the idle state and what not but is there a way to manually grab the messages when it's staying idle?

no, your BIS is on a schedule and you can't manually tell it to get mail.
Sorry.

The BIS cycle is every 15 minutes,
then two minutes,
if mail, then two again
if none, back to 15.
Roughly speaking.
